Ankaragücü MKE

On November 30, 2018, Bayndr made his Süper Lig debut with MKE Ankaragücü against Aykur Rizespor, and the match finished in a 1-0 victory.

On July 8, 2019, Bayndr signed a four-year contract with Fenerbahçe.After disagreeing with teammate Harun Tekin over performance, Bayndr was elevated to first-choice goalie.At ükrü Saracolu Stadium, he made his Fenerbahçe debut on August 19, 2019, playing against Gazişehir Gaziantep F.K. Fenerbahçe won 5–0.

On October 3, 2020, during Fenerbahçe’s 2-1 victory over Fatih Karagümrük in their fourth match, Bayndr stopped a penalty shot attempt by Erik Sabo. On December 6, 2020, during Fenerbahçe’s 2-0 victory over Denizlispor in the 11th week of play, he stopped another penalty attempt from Radosaw Murawski. In this game, he made a total of seven saves as Fenerbahçe was reduced to ten men after Serdar Aziz was declared out.

In the 69th minute of a 2–1 away loss against Konyaspor on October 30, 2021, Bayndr was hurt in a collision with Serdar Gürler and left the field, being replaced by Berke Zer.  The declaration came from Fenerbahçe the next day: “Acromioclavicular separation was observed, but no fracture was found in Altay Bayndr’s shoulder.” Our player’s treatment was initiated, and an operation was agreed upon.In fact, It was anticipated that he would miss about three months of action.

In the 2018 Toulon Tournament, international youth Bayndr played for the Turkey U-20 team.Enol Güneş invited Senior Bayndr to Turkey for the November 9, 2020, UEFA Nations League matches against Russia and Hungary. On May 27, 2021, he made his debut against Azerbaijan in a friendly match.
